The 440-18X has replaced the proven 440-18. It is being redesigned to ship in a 48" long package to save on shipping.


FEATURES:

M2 is always trying to design and build new antennas to fit the needs of amateur radio operators. The “X” series of antennas are all designed to keep the packaging under 48” long to minimize oversize surcharges applied by shippers. The “X” series antennas offer the same performance as its predecessor, but with shorter boom sections.The boom sections also have a thicker wall for added strength.A side benefit of the “X” series antennas are that they are more portable with the smaller sections.The 440-18X replaces our very popular 440-18. The 440-18X is a computer optimized broadband yagi featuring an excellent pattern and good gain across its bandwidth. It can be mounted vertically or horizontally and is ideal for stacking two or more for additional gain. Light weight yet sturdy construction keep the cost low and the performance high. Use it for ATV, OSCAR, FM, LONG HAUL TROPO, ETC. We guarantee you will be impressed. The heart of the 440-18X is a unique Driven Element Module with superior weather resistance and power handling abilities. All connectors are O-ring sealed to the CNC machined block and internal connections are sealed in a space-age silicone gel with a dielectric strength nearly 4 times greater than air. The Balun coax connectors are triple O-ring sealed. Other key mechanical and electrical parts are CNC machinedfrom 6061-T6 aluminum and all hardware except U-bolts is stainless steel.The 440-18X offers you uncompromising performance, enduring mechanical construction, and long term electrical integrity.


SPECIFICATIONS:

Model ......................................... 440-18X
Frequency Range ......................... 420 To 450 MHz
*Gain ......................................... 16.5 dBi
Front to back ............................... 24 dB Typical
Beamwidth .................................. E=27° H=32°
Feed type .................................... Folded Dipole
Feed Impedance. ......................... 50 Ohms Unbalanced
Maximum VSWR .......................... 1.5:1 Average
Input Connector .......................... “N” Female

Power Handling ........................... 1.5 kW
Boom Length / Dia ...................... 135”’ / 1” To 3/4”
Maximum Element Length ............ 14”
Turning Radius: ........................... 69’
Stacking Distance ........................ 51” High & 52” Wide
Mast Size .................................... 2”
Wind area / Survival .................... 0.68 Sq. Ft. / 100 MPH
Weight / Ship Wt. ........................ 5 Lbs. / 7 Lbs.


 *Subtract 2.14 from dBi for dBd
